Getting to know Lucinda Evans Faison-Olsen

Hi there, I’m Lucy! My name is Lucy Olsen, and I am a Licensed Marriage Family Therapist (LMFT) based in San Diego, California, working with clients statewide via Telehealth. I earned my Bachelor’s degree from Hollins University. I work with children, adolescents, adults, individuals, couples, and families, specializing in anxiety, depression, and problem-solving. Using Client-Centered Therapy and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, I help my clients make progress and start feeling better. My approach My approach to therapy varies based on the needs of each client I work with. I most frequently use Client-Centered Therapy and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, as both modalities help me and the client build a shared understanding of their reality and allow us to work together to chart a path forward. My focus I have found that my style and approach are a good fit for clients dealing with the challenges of depression and anxiety. I work to help my clients navigate these feelings and build skills that allow them to feel better about themselves and develop a more positive outlook on life. My communication style My communication style is open, accommodating, and personable. I want my clients to feel comfortable talking with me about anything, and I pride myself on my listening and rapport-building skills. My journey to mental healthcare I became a therapist because I have always wanted to help people. Whether it was babysitting, volunteering in school and my community, or being a trusted friend, I have always been drawn to helping others. I enjoy seeing individuals become the best version of themselves. My goals for you My approach to goal setting with clients is all about working together to understand what you want to accomplish in our time together. This starts by building trust and rapport between us and getting comfortable with what it means to be in therapy. Over time, we will work together to set goals and track your progress.
